Discover the Premier Carver-Hawkeye Arena

The Carver-Hawkeye Arena is more than an arena — it's a premier home court and concert stage that delivers electric, can’t-miss moments in Iowa City. Tucked on the University of Iowa campus, this multi-purpose venue draws fans from across the region for powerhouse college sports and big-name shows. If you’re mapping out your view, the Carver Hawkeye Arena seating chart showcases its signature bowl design with excellent sightlines throughout.

Opened in 1983 with a seating capacity of 15,056, the arena’s bowl-shaped configuration brings you close to the action from nearly every seat. Partially set into a hillside, it boasts a distinctive campus profile and an energetic in-venue atmosphere. Recent upgrades to modern video boards and the sound system heighten clarity, energy, and immersion for every game, meet, or show.

As the heartbeat of Hawkeye athletics, the arena hosts Iowa Hawkeyes men’s and women’s basketball, wrestling, gymnastics, and volleyball — plus major tournaments and special events. It has welcomed Big Ten and NCAA Wrestling Championships, as well as Big Ten and NCAA regional and national Gymnastics Championships. On the entertainment side, Carver-Hawkeye Arena has hosted legends like Elton John, Bruce Springsteen, Metallica, Garth Brooks, Pearl Jam, The Rolling Stones, Shania Twain, and Dave Matthews Band, making Carver Hawkeye Arena events a year-round draw.

Location and Transportation

Venue Address

Carver-Hawkeye Arena

1 Elliott Dr

Iowa City, IA 52242

Carver-Hawkeye Arena sits on the University of Iowa campus in Iowa City — about 30 miles from Cedar Rapids, making it an easy regional destination for fans and families.

  • Parking: On-site parking is available in adjacent lots and ramps. Event parking fees typically apply (usually $5–$10). Arrive early for the best spots.
  • Public Transit: Iowa City Transit buses serve the campus with stops near the arena.
  • Rideshare & Dropoff: Designated pickup and dropoff zones are available near the main entrance.

Security and Policies

  • Bag Policy: Clear bags only (maximum size: 12"x6"x12"); small clutch bags allowed (up to 4.5"x6.5").
  • Prohibited Items: Weapons, outside food/beverage, large bags, noisemakers, professional cameras (without credential), umbrellas, selfie sticks.
  • Re-entry Policy: No re-entry once you exit the venue.
  • Service Animals: ADA-compliant service animals are welcome.

Accessibility

Carver-Hawkeye Arena is ADA-accessible, with accessible seating located throughout the venue at various price levels. Elevators and ramps provide access to all seating levels, and assistive listening devices are available upon request to support guests with hearing needs.

Other Things to Do in Iowa City

Beyond the sports and concerts, the Iowa City area offers incredible attractions for visitors heading to Carver-Hawkeye Arena:

  • Old Capitol Museum — Historic former state capitol building with exhibits on Iowa history.
  • Iowa Avenue Literary Walk — Sidewalk tribute to famous writers with ties to Iowa City.
  • University of Iowa Museum of Art — Renowned collection of visual art, including works by Grant Wood and Jackson Pollock.
  • Pedestrian Mall (Ped Mall) — Vibrant downtown area with shops, restaurants, and public art.
  • Devonian Fossil Gorge — Outdoor site where visitors can explore 375-million-year-old fossils.
  • Terry Trueblood Recreation Area — Lakeside park with trails, boating, and picnic areas.
  • Hickory Hill Park — Large natural park with hiking trails and scenic views.
  • Museum of Natural History — University museum featuring exhibits on natural sciences and Iowa’s ecosystems.
  • Herbert Hoover Presidential Library and Museum (West Branch) — Museum dedicated to the 31st U.S. President, just east of Iowa City.
